Output 266360611c7dc7aeebbd7e3ad7b6cd996e029fe5595d52f7c32bc8960ac940b6:0

value
1045456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1777a2c121409a4dfd7d234bedce94eab08324a2 OP_EQUAL
address
33q6nPpA9bsqG59Hkq7eLkMWhDDcTX9Ru9
transaction
266360611c7dc7aeebbd7e3ad7b6cd996e029fe5595d52f7c32bc8960ac940b6
spent
true